Output 73e8e4b8e59fcf94deaffbed38521687e4d9cae636668bc1058b3f7502ba75b8:1

value
202429488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e756795b57535c9a1279248b3bfbe6eea92d14 OP_EQUAL
address
3PeoEDPdqMXRQC5RpzqHQ89bof34Y28zWp
transaction
73e8e4b8e59fcf94deaffbed38521687e4d9cae636668bc1058b3f7502ba75b8
confirmations
264148
spent
true